Before the start of December intense cold conditions have started to be witnessed in the state as mercury dipped to 6.3 degree celsius, and the state is firmly in the grip of cold conditions.
Nowgong was the coldest place in the state by recording night temperature at 6.3 degree celsius. Bhopal recorded night temperature at 12.4 degree celsius while day was recorded at 26.3 degree celsius. Among the nearby areas of the state capital regions which was coldest was Raisen which recorded night at 7.2 degree celsius.
The major cities are witnessing severe cold weather conditions,Indore recorded night temperature at 12.2 degree celsius, Jabalpur recorded night temperature at 10.7 degree celsius while Gwalior was the coldest city among the major cities by recording night temperature at 8.9 degree celsius.
Trend of intense cold weather conditions was witnessed across the state and several regions recorded night temperature below 10 degree celsius.
The regions which recorded night temperature below 10 degree celsius were (in degree celsius) Datia 8.4, Rajgarh 9.5, Umaria 8.7, Narsinghpur 8.8.
According to the Met, the effect of the cold will increase from December 5 and at the same time, the mercury is likely to remain below 8 degree celsius in most of the cities.
According to the information, due to the northern winds coming from the Himalayas, fluctuations in temperature are being seen across the state including Bhopal, Indore for the past 2-3 days. It is estimated to remain like this for the next 72 hours but after that the temperatures would steep decline.
